# Ledgerline payments service — integration test env
# Reviewer notes: the flaky tests trace back to the mock
# gateway resetting between suites. FLAKE_RETRY_MAX=3 is a
# stopgap; the real fix lands next sprint. Keep GATEWAY_MODE
# set to 'sandbox' for all CI runs. The sandbox gateway still
# requires its auth credential, which is set on the next line.

env line for fafof-fahag: LEDGER_TOKEN5=f8790

Runbook 7.3 – Signed Contract Transfer

Signed contract pouches from the Larchbrook office arrive at Tyneholt reception each Tuesday before noon. Receiving staff verify the tamper seal, count documents against the enclosed slip, and store the pouch in the locked cabinet pending legal review. Do not photocopy contents. Upon the courier's arrival, carry out the hand-over instruction given below.

handover note for yagef-bagep: the drudor pelius courier leaves the kasdor zorvan norir ledger at gate 8016 under passcode 755406

**Ticket PIX-housekeeping:** Heads up — the exif-scrub sidecar on Lumenframe started rejecting uploads this morning. Signature check fails on every scrubbed image because the scrubber re-signs with the retired staging key, not the prod one. Marva rotated keys last sprint but the sidecar config never got updated. Quick fix: swap the key in the scrubber's env and restart the pod. For reference, the current valid signing key is below.

deploy key for kahof-tadup: bky4_rRMZ